Program/Service Description:
The Coalition of Wisconsin Aging Group is a statewide federation of more than 600 organizations which represent and serve Wisconsin's older adults. A non profit, non partisan group incorporated in 1978, CWAG provides information on matters of concern to older adults and represents Wisconsin's older adults major civic and political issues. CWAG programs also provide legal advocacy and counseling on issues related to older adults such as public benefits, guardianship issues, housing and consumer issues. There are member groups located in all 72 Wisconsin counties.
